The Story of the Forget-Me-Not Emblem
The Forget-Me-Not Emblem, a symbol in German Masonry from 1926, gained prominence between World War 1 and 2. Amidst Nazi threats in 1934, it became a substitute for Masonic identification, surviving through charity and symbolizing Masonry’s resilience. Adopted by the Grand Lodge of the Sun in 1947, it represents the rekindling of Masonic light. Read more
